The clock is ticking for China Evergrande Group to announce a detailed debt restructuring plan.
The defaulted developer at the center of China’s broader property debt crisis faces a March 20 court hearing in Hong Kong on a winding-up petition. The judge had urged the firm last year to present “something more concrete” at the gathering.
